Job description

MERL is seeking a highly motivated and qualified intern to conduct research on robotic disassembly. There are several research topics of interest, including task and sequence planning, learning skills, perception under occlusion, contact-rich manipulation, and vision-language models for acting under uncertainty. Applicants must be Ph.D. students with strong backgrounds in robot learning or computer vision. The selected intern will collaborate closely with MERL researchers to design and implement novel algorithms, conduct experiments, and disseminate research findings through a top-tier conference. The start date and duration are flexible, and interested applicants are encouraged to apply with an updated CV and a list of relevant publications. Required Specific Experience: The pay range for this internship position will be 6-8K per month. Mitsubishi Electric Research Labs, Inc.
